#656b82 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#656b82 is composed of 39.6% red, 42%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.3%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 227.6 degrees, a saturation of 12.6% and a lightness of 45.3%. #656b82 color hex could be obtained by blending #cad6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#656b82

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070709 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#656b82

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7079 is the less saturated color, while #0332e4 is the most saturated one.
